Questions and concerns continue one year after the #RejectFinanceBill2024 protests in Kenya

Summary by pbicanada.org
Photo: Tear gas used against Kenya budget protests, June 26, 2024. Image from Wikimedia/Capital FM Kenya. We are at the one-year anniversary of the protests in Kenya against the Finance Bill, widely known as #RejectFinanceBill2024.
